Article L224-38 of the French Monetary and Financial Code

In the event of the transfer referred to in the fifth paragraph of article L. 224-6, the choice of a new manager is subject to a competitive tender procedure and is submitted to the general meeting of the subscribing association, on the recommendation of the supervisory committee. Article L231-3 of the French Monetary and Financial Code

It is punishable by two years’ imprisonment and a fine of 750,000 euros to direct, in law or in fact, an undertaking which engages in collective investment in transferable securities without having been authorised or which continues its activity despite the withdrawal of authorisation.
